About the Role

In this role you will collaborate with both local and region-wide IT teams to deliver support to several offices. The selected candidate will handle daily IT support for the local office and provide helpdesk assistance to end‑users across the region. • Provide support on our corporate IT Helpdesk • Install new printers/copiers/plotters and other office equipment • Install and support enterprise applications • Perform data maintenance and data archiving • Assist with office moves/expansions

What You Bring

Qualified candidates should have a passion for technology, a business mindset, strong communication and customer‑service skills, and the ability to travel. A bachelor’s degree in IT, Computer Science or a related field with 0‑2 years of experience, or an associate’s degree with 3+ years, is required. Knowledge of Windows 10, Office 365, Teams, OneDrive, Exchange 365, Windows Server, Active Directory, basic networking, and printing/file permissions is expected, along with the ability to troubleshoot PC‑level issues and manage user accounts.

Benefits

Kimley‑Horn offers a comprehensive benefits package that includes retirement matching, health coverage, flexible time off, financial wellness programs, professional development opportunities, and family‑friendly resources. • Exceptional Retirement Plan: 2‑to‑1 company match on up to 4% of eligible compensation and additional profit‑sharing contribution • Comprehensive Health Coverage: low‑cost medical, dental, and vision insurance options • Time Off: personal leave, flexible scheduling, floating holidays, and half‑day Fridays • Financial Wellness: student loan matching in our 401(k) and performance‑based bonuses • Professional Development: tuition reimbursement and extensive internal training programs • Family‑Friendly Benefits: new parent leave, family building benefits, and childcare resources
